How do you make cucumber salt and vinegar chips?

Pat cucumbers dry with paper towels and place in a medium bowl. Add vinegar, salt, and garlic powder and toss to combine. Place cucumbers in an even layer on prepared baking sheets. Bake until dried out, 1 hour and 30 minutes, flipping halfway through.
